HOMME PLISSÉ ISSEY MIYAKE FW22 Elevates Sculptural Design

HOMME PLISSÉ ISSEY MIYAKE proves that pleats are not going away anytime soon with its Fall/Winter 2022 collection. Titled “A WORK OF ARC,” the new collection imparts sculptural design notes on a range of pleated staples.

Inspired by the form of a tent, the label utilizes its adaptable frame as a method of design for the new collection. Movement remains a focal point as tops, bottoms and coats fold and crease just like a tent does — giving way to three-dimensional exploration. By playing with new forms, the collection presents the evolving reality of how staples garments can not only move but rest on the body. The dynamic subtleties of movement and form are brought to life in the collection video directed by Kyotaro Hayashi.

The collection consists of several series that each looks to a different aspect of a tent’s construction. Inspired by a tent’s structure, the ARC series presents a light gray top, a rust-colored jacket and black pants with arched folds and fluid design elements. Taking its inspiration from the bow shape of a tarp, the BOW series features a loose three-dimensional two-piece set in sea moss yellow and other tops in ocean and forest-toned colorways.

Next up is the FLIP COAT in coral, olive green and chalk colorways that can be transformed from a coat into a light jacket. For another outerwear offering, the FRAME COAT series features a padded and matte-textured fabric construction in jade green and toffee brown. The MONTHLY COLOR SEPTEMBER series is an outerwear highlight with a triangular three-dimensional form that creates a voluminous silhouette.

Another standout offering from the collection is the LANTERN series that invokes the glowing light of a lantern that seeps through a tent. The series presents multicolored print designs in turquoise, rust, gray, muted yellow and black on cardigans, pants and an eye-catching triangular coat.  Rounding out the offering is the DECK’N COURT collaborative shoe series between HOMME PLISSÉ ISSEY MIYAKE and WAKOUWA. The low-top silhouettes come in crisp white and brown colorways with subtle piping detailing.
